Ducati has launched the much-awaited 2021 Streetfighter V4 and V4S in the Indian market. The 2021 Ducati Streetfighter V4 & V4S performance street naked motorcycles are priced at Rs 19.99 lakh and Rs 22.99 lakh, ex-showroom (India).

The 2021 Streetfighter V4 and the V4S motorcycles now feature a host of upgrades. This includes new electronics and an updated MotoGP derived power unit. The Streetfighter V4 line-up is the brand’s flagship naked motorcycle offering in the world.

The 2021 Streetfighter V4 is available in a single Ducati red colour option. While the Streetfighter V4S is offered in two colour options: Ducati Red and Dark Stealth. Bookings are now open across all Ducati dealerships in the country with deliveries said to begin soon after the lockdown ends.

The 2021 Streetfighter V4 and the V4S are powered by an updated version of the same engine that was on the previous versions of the motorcycles. The 1,103cc Desmosedici Stradale 90° V4 engine produces a maximum of 206bhp at 13,000rpm and 123Nm of peak torque at 9.500rpm.

The engine comes mated to a six-speed gearbox with the (DQS) Ducati Quick Shift EVO 2 bi-directional and a slip-assisted clutch. The motorcycle tips the scale at 201kg and 199kg on the Streetfighter V4 and the V4S, respectively.

Power and torque figures of the motorcycle can be raised to 217bhp and 130 Nm by fitting the full-racing Ducati Performance exhaust by Akrapovic. It also reduces the weight of the motorcycle by 6kg. All this means the motorcycle can sprint from 0 to 100kmph in under 3 seconds and continue to reach an electronically limited top speed of 270kmph.

The Streetfighter V4 models also feature a 5-inch TFT colour display for the instrument console. Along with the switchgear present on the motorcycle, the rider can control the plethora of electronics equipped by Ducati to extract maximum performance.

This includes multiple riding modes, various power modes, cornering ABS EVO, (DTC) Ducati Traction Control EVO 2, (DWC) Ducati Wheelie Control EVO, (DSC) Ducati Slide Control, (EBC) Engine Brake Control EVO, and Auto tyre calibration.

Suspension duties on the standard motorcycle are handled by a 43mm fully-adjustable USD Showa BPF at the front and a fully-adjustable Sachs mono-shock unit at the rear. On the other hand, the V4S features electronically-adjustable Ohlins NIX30 USD forks at the front and Ohlins TTX36 mono-shock units at the rear.

Braking on both motorcycles is done via dual 330mm semi-floating discs with radially-mounted Brembo Monobloc Stylema M4.30 4-piston callipers at the front and a single 245mm disc with a two-piston calliper at the rear.

The standard Streetfighter V4 motorcycle features five-spoke 17-inch alloy wheels, while the V4S features lighter Marchesini 3-spoke forged aluminium alloy wheels. Both motorcycles come shod with Pirelli Diablo Rosso Corsa II performance tyres at both ends.

The 2021 Streetfighter V4 and the V4S are among the few of the naked motorcycles having a power output of over 200bhp. The Italian performance nakeds rivals the Triumph Speed Triple 1200 RS and the Kawasaki Ninja Z H2 in the Indian market.
